#6d5c78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d5c78 is composed of 42.7% red, 36.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.2%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 276.4 degrees, a saturation of 13.2% and a lightness of 41.6%. #6d5c78 color hex could be obtained by blending #dab8f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6d5c78 color description : Dark grayish violet.
#6d5c78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d5c78 has RGB values of R:109, G:92,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7167096.
